SPDX-License-Identifier: GPL-2.0 + +.. include:: + +NPCM video driver +================= + +This driver is used to control the Video Capture/Differentiation (VCD) engine +and Encoding Compression Engine (ECE) present on Nuvoton NPCM SoCs. The VCD can +capture a frame from digital video input and compare two frames in memory, and +the ECE can compress the frame data into HEXTILE format. + +Driver-specific Controls +------------------------ + +V4L2_CID_NPCM_CAPTURE_MODE +~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~ + +The VCD engine supports two modes: + +- COMPLETE mode: + + Capture the next complete frame into memory. + +- DIFF mode: + + Compare the incoming frame with the frame stored in memory, and updates the + differentiated frame in memory. + +Application can use ``V4L2_CID_NPCM_CAPTURE_MODE`` control to set the VCD mode +with different control values (enum v4l2_npcm_capture_mode): + +- ``V4L2_NPCM_CAPTURE_MODE_COMPLETE``: will set VCD to COMPLETE mode. +- ``V4L2_NPCM_CAPTURE_MODE_DIFF``: will set VCD to DIFF mode. + +V4L2_CID_NPCM_RECT_COUNT +~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~ + +If using V4L2_PIX_FMT_HEXTILE format, VCD will capture frame data and then ECE +will compress the data into HEXTILE rectangles and store them in V4L2 video +buffer with the layout defined in Remote Framebuffer Protocol: +:: + + (RFC 6143, https://www.rfc-editor.org/rfc/rfc6143.html#section-7.6.1) + + +--------------+--------------+-------------------+ + | No. of bytes | Type [Value] | Description | + +--------------+--------------+-------------------+ + | 2 | U16 | x-position | + | 2 | U16 | y-position | + | 2 | U16 | width | + | 2 | U16 | height | + | 4 | S32 | encoding-type (5) | + +--------------+--------------+-------------------+ + | HEXTILE rectangle data | + +-------------------------------------------------+ + +Application can get the video buffer through VIDIOC_DQBUF, and followed by +calling ``V4L2_CID_NPCM_RECT_COUNT`` control to get the number of HEXTILE +rectangles in this buffer. + +References +---------- +include/uapi/linux/npcm-video.h + +**Copyright** |copy| 2022 Nuvoton Technologies diff --git a/include/uapi/linux/npcm-video.h b/include/uapi/linux/npcm-video.h new file mode 100644 index 000000000000..1d39f6f38c96 --- /dev/null +++ b/include/uapi/linux/npcm-video.h @@ -0,0 +1,41 @@ +/* SPDX-License-Identifier: GPL-2.0+ WITH Linux-syscall-note */ +/* + * Controls header for NPCM video driver + * + * Copyright (C) 2022 Nuvoton Technologies + */ + +#ifndef _UAPI_LINUX_NPCM_VIDEO_H +#define _UAPI_LINUX_NPCM_VIDEO_H + +#include + +/* + * Check Documentation/userspace-api/media/drivers/npcm-video.rst for control + * details. + */ + +/* + * This control is meant to set the mode of NPCM Video Capture/Differentiation + * (VCD) engine. + * + * The VCD engine supports two modes: + * COMPLETE - Capture the next complete frame into memory. + * DIFF - Compare the incoming frame with the frame stored in memory, and + * updates the differentiated frame in memory. + */ +#define V4L2_CID_NPCM_CAPTURE_MODE (V4L2_CID_USER_NPCM_BASE + 0) + +enum v4l2_npcm_capture_mode { + V4L2_NPCM_CAPTURE_MODE_COMPLETE = 0, /* COMPLETE mode */ + V4L2_NPCM_CAPTURE_MODE_DIFF = 1, /* DIFF mode */ +}; + +/* + * This control is meant to get the count of compressed HEXTILE rectangles which + * is relevant to the number of differentiated frames if VCD is in DIFF mode. + * And the count will always be 1 if VCD is in COMPLETE mode. + */ +#define V4L2_CID_NPCM_RECT_COUNT (V4L2_CID_USER_NPCM_BASE + 1) + +#endif /* _UAPI_LINUX_NPCM_VIDEO_H */
